Open Menu
Companies>Blade Therapeutics
Last Modified07/02/2023 12:00 AM
cover
Blade Therapeutics icon

Blade Therapeutics

Employee Participants2
Total Rating36
Revenue$0

Blade Therapeutics is a discovery stage drug development company. Read More

Headquarters South San Francisco, CA, USA
Phone Number (650)278-4291